Kaden's Secret: Part 4

Date: March 25th, 1999, several hours after the funeral of Padraig Shea Sr, Kaden's grandfather
Location: Kaden's family home in West Ireland
"What are you asking?"
"If these things exist, I want to see them. I feel like I've been missing some huge piece of the world."
"It's not so simple. You can't just learn to see them and have that be it. It changes who you are. You know how I get sometimes when I go and disappear for a while? That will happen to you too. Anyway its just not done. It wasn't even supposed to be done to me."
"Are you the only one?"
"I've never met another. There might be, somewhere. I mean, there are tons of fae everywhere, maybe there's another one who disobeyed and made someone like me."
Rini screwed up her face in thought. "What if YOU changed me? Can you?"
A loud crashing sound as Orlaithe reappeared "No she can't. We would never have given her that power but..."
"But what?" Both women took on the same confused look.
"Enough time around someone, enough of the right KIND of time... It is somewhat... catching. Especially now that your friend is..."
"Primed? Now that I know there's something there to be seen."
Orlaithe nodded solemnly and Kaden stared on in disbelief. "then why hasn't it ever happened to anyone else I know. My friends, my lovers, none of them could see."
This elicited a shrug from Orlaithe but Rini knew the answer instantly:
"Kaden, you told me you never had a close friend for more than a few months or a lover for more than a few weeks. No way that's enough time, especially if you NEVER told anyone. The only people who have been in your life enough are your family and..."
"... and they already knew."
"Indeed, perhaps this is why we have been the only friends who've stayed with you. You deny them so much of yourself to keep your secret"
Kaden was shocked by what she heard coming out of Orlaithe's mouth "You were the one who told me not to explain! You said it was dangerous! And then I told and I ended up in a fucking mental hospital!" Kaden's eyes turned red and her body shook, tears streaming down her face.
"And your secrecy kept you safe but its time now. And for you Rini, I don't suppose you have very long to wait for whatever transformation will come to you. I'll tell you the same thing I told her 11 years ago; be careful what you say, be careful who you tell. "
With that, Orlaithe flew off leaving the two women to wait for the change.
